If you've been recently diagnosed with psoriasis, your dermatologist will go over all the ins and outs of proper skincare. Two of the key topics shall be concerning moisturizing as well as bathing. Bathing generally is a fantastic way to manage the discomfort as well as aching skin psoriasis can cause.
Your doctor will firmly advise against taking very long baths or showers and also tell you to stay away from hot water. Most bathing should take place as quick as you possibley can and in lukewarm water. You may possibly not need to shower or bathe each day along with doing so can in fact be more harmful to the skin by drying it out. Once you have finished with the bath or shower, pat yourself dry and be sure to moisturize the skin completely subsequently to keep in the moisture.
A lot of showers or baths can dry up the skin substantially in the event that proper care is not taken right after that. Dry skin is a worst nightmare for a person who is prone to skin psoriasis because dry skin equals itchy skin. Itchy skin results in another flare-up.
Doctors will show you short showers and baths are acceptable. Having a shower can certainly help facilitate alleviating the symptoms of skin psoriasis as well as can give the body a lot of the moisture it requires. However, it is necessary to capture as well as secure that moisture by making use of skin creams and also lotions.
Any time drying off, keep away from quick rubbing movements that you could be utilized to. Preferably, pat yourself dry and also softly get rid of the surplus water from your body. You don't need to be completely dry in order to use a skin moisturizer, the little amount of water must be there to keep your skin hydrated. Right after toweling off, implement the lotion so the excess water doesn't evaporate.
It may help to add some oils into the tub like olive oil, mineral oil, or vegetable oil. These oils can help relieve the skin along with battle off inflammation. Including some Epson salt can help relieve several of the symptoms as well, as well as assists in keeping those dry, blotchy spots away.
Baths or showers may also help keep your skin moisturized and also alleviate some of the pain skin psoriasis causes. Just be sure you limit how much time you spend in showers or baths and also keep the water lukewarm.
